Case Manager
37.5 hours/week - Full Time Term position (September 2022 – December 2022) Potential for renewal Primary Work Location: Hubbards and Chester (Travel within Lunenburg County) Position Summary: Case Managers are responsible for assessing an individual’s employment/career needs and identify those who are suitable for case management. Case Managers work with these individuals in a collaborative, client driven process to develop a Return To Work Action Plan (RTWAP). The actions of a Case Manager must address the specific needs of the client as documented in their goals. The Case Manager must support accountability by organizing service delivery that is appropriate, coordinated, and timely to address client needs and desired outcomes. Core Competencies:
